Skip to main content

userMessageListener

codebolt.chat.userMessageListener(): undefined
Sets up a listener for incoming WebSocket messages and emits a custom event when a message is received.

Response Structure

This method returns an event emitter that can be used to listen for incoming WebSocket messages. The emitter allows you to set up custom event handlers for processing messages.

Example

// Set up a user message listener
const emitter = codebolt.chat.userMessageListener();

// Listen for custom events
emitter.on('message', (message) => {
console.log('Received message:', message);
});

Explanation

This function sets up a listener for incoming WebSocket messages and returns an event emitter for handling custom events when messages are received.